Analysis

The most recent figure for computer, communications and other services in Egypt is 14.0%, measured in 2025.

The figure is up 13.1% on the previous year and up 32.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, computer, communications and other services in Egypt peaked at 34.2% in 1998 and was at its lowest, 9.2%, in 2018.

Egypt ranks 142nd of 198 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 49 years of available data.

Computer, communications and other services include such activities as international telecommunications, and postal and courier services; computer data; news-related service transactions between residents and nonresidents; construction services; royalties and license fees; miscellaneous business, professional, and technical services; and personal, cultural, and recreational services. This indicator is expressed as a percentage of service exports which are commercial services provided by residents to non-residents.
